Not sure the source of this problem, but recently I ran into the following issue. Seeking advice...
1.) Converted flac audio files to m4a using fre:ac v1.1.7 Apple silicon version. Output files play correctly on macOS 15.7.2 (e.g. QuickTime).
2) Copied m4a files to USB thumb drive (formatted as FAT32); drive contains other m4a files that play correctly.
3) Played the USB new m4a files on my Mazda infotainment system. They play fine, BUT.... the stated duration is TWICE the length it is supposed to be (e.g. 4:13 song is shown as ~8:26). Consequently, the music is heard correctly from start to finish, but followed by the same duration of silence.
Any idea what might be going on here?
